Paperback. Condición: New. Print on Demand. This book argues the early conversion of children is essential and possible. The author, a 19th-century Methodist minister, claims all infants are born justified, meaning they are not subject to condemnation for the sin of Adam. Consequently, the author asserts that baptism does not co…nfer a state of holiness but rather recognizes a state of justification. The author contends that all children not only possess initial life (a degree of spiritual life unconditionally imparted by the Holy Spirit) but can have regenerating life (the beginning of a close relationship with Jesus) at the earliest age. Drawing on Scripture, the author maintains that children possess the intellectual, moral, and emotional capacity to experience spiritual conviction, repentance, faith, and regeneration. The author passionately advocates for the spiritual nurture of children and warns against the devastating effects of delaying conversion. They recognize the profound impact of innate depravity but believe the grace of God can overcome this obstacle. The author encourages parents to diligently instruct their children, emphasizing the importance of prayer, religious example, and seeking the earliest conversion possible.
